Lima traz VMs Linux leves para Windows e outros hosts
Experimente Lima (Máquinas Linux) dos Autores do Lima, uma utilidade que executa máquinas virtuais Linux em hosts não Linux para desenvolvimento e teste de contêineres. Ele lança ambientes Linux para que os desenvolvedores possam executar ferramentas e cargas de trabalho nativas de contêiner com integração automática ao host e configuração declarativa de instâncias. Modelos de tempo de execução de contêiner integrados, suporte a múltiplas arquiteturas e rede automatizada reduzem a fricção de configuração para fluxos de trabalho multiplataforma. Desenvolvedores, engenheiros de DevOps e pesquisadores obtêm uma solução de VM compacta adequada para sandboxing e teste de contêineres multiplataforma. O projeto é de código aberto sob a licença Apache 2.0.
Como o Lima se encaixa nos fluxos de trabalho de desenvolvimento centrados em contêineres
O Lima fornece uma camada de VM que permite que ferramentas nativas do Linux sejam executadas em hosts não-Linux. A ferramenta lança instâncias Linux projetadas para desenvolvimento e teste, permitindo que cargas de trabalho de contêiner e utilitários nativos do Linux operem fora de uma instalação nativa do Linux. Ela suporta múltiplas distribuições de convidados e integra tempos de execução de contêiner, o que a torna prática para equipes que precisam de ambientes reprodutíveis para desenvolvimento, solução de problemas de CI ou validação local de contêiner.
O Lima mantém o uso de recursos do host baixo durante tarefas rotineiras?
O projeto se posiciona como uma alternativa leve a suítes de virtualização de desktop completas. O feedback da comunidade destaca a baixa sobrecarga de recursos e desempenho satisfatório para cargas de trabalho de contêiner. A emulação multi-arquitetura suporta casos de uso Intel-on-ARM e ARM-on-Intel, o que auxilia testes entre plataformas sem exigir máquinas físicas separadas. No Windows, o Lima opera sobre backends de virtualização comuns, como WSL2 ou QEMU.
O Lima é apropriado para sandboxing e fluxos de trabalho conscientes da segurança?
O Lima executa ambientes Linux em VMs isoladas adequadas para sandboxing e pesquisa. A licença open-source Apache 2.0 do projeto e a manutenção sob a Cloud Native Computing Foundation em nível de incubação aumentam a transparência e a revisão da comunidade. Essa visibilidade ajuda os usuários a verificar o comportamento e auditar o código, o que é importante ao usar ambientes de convidados para experimentos de segurança ou sandboxing de agentes.
Os usuários precisam de conhecimento técnico para operar o Lima de forma eficaz?
A ferramenta é direcionada a usuários com mentalidade técnica que se sentem confortáveis com fluxos de trabalho de linha de comando. A configuração é declarativa via YAML e a utilidade expõe modelos para motores de contêiner e clusters leves, de modo que equipes que gerenciam infraestrutura como código podem automatizar instâncias. Usuários casuais devem esperar uma curva de aprendizado em torno de backends de VM e manifestos de instância, enquanto desenvolvedores e pessoal de DevOps obtêm reprodutibilidade e configurações baseadas em modelos.
Lima é uma escolha prática e orientada pela comunidade com um compromisso operacional
Como Lima é de código aberto sob a licença Apache 2.0 e mantida no programa de incubação da CNCF, ela se adequa a desenvolvedores que priorizam transparência e governança comunitária. O principal compromisso é a sobrecarga operacional de gerenciar backends de virtualização e interfaces em evolução durante o desenvolvimento ativo. Equipes que aceitam esse fardo de manutenção ganham uma rota confiável e de baixa sobrecarga para ambientes de teste e sandbox Linux reprodutíveis.
Prós
O compartilhamento automático de arquivos via SSHFS ou VirtioFS simplifica o acesso host-convidado
Suporte de runtime de contêiner embutido, incluindo containerd, nerdctl e Docker
A emulação de múltiplas arquiteturas permite testes entre plataformas sem hardware extra
A configuração YAML declarativa produz instâncias de VM reproduzíveis
Contras
Requer familiaridade com a linha de comando e arquivos de configuração declarativa
No Windows, depende do WSL2 ou dos backends de virtualização QEMU
O status do projeto em incubação significa desenvolvimento ativo e interfaces em evolução
As leis relativas ao uso deste software estão sujeitas à legislação de cada país. Não incentivamos ou autorizamos o uso deste programa se ele violar essas leis. O Softonic pode receber uma comissão se você clicar ou comprar qualquer um dos produtos apresentados aqui.